What is digital contract signing
Digital contract signing refers to the process of electronically signing contracts and agreements using eSignature technology. This method allows individuals and businesses to sign documents securely and efficiently without the need for physical paper. Digital contract signing ensures that all parties involved can verify their identities and the integrity of the signed document, making it a trusted alternative to traditional signing methods.

Legal use of digital contract signing
Digital contract signing is legally recognized in the United States under the Electronic Signatures in Global and National Commerce (ESIGN) Act and the Uniform Electronic Transactions Act (UETA). These laws establish that electronic signatures hold the same legal weight as handwritten signatures, provided that both parties consent to use electronic means for signing. This legal framework ensures that digital contracts are enforceable in court.

Examples of using digital contract signing
Digital contract signing can be applied across various industries and scenarios. Common examples include:
- Real estate transactions, where purchase agreements are signed electronically.
- Human resources, for onboarding documents and employment contracts.
- Sales agreements in business transactions.
- Legal documents, including non-disclosure agreements and service contracts.
